What owners report

“THE REAR WINDOW IN HAS BECOME UNGLUED AND FELL OUT. CHRYSLER HAS BEEN GETTING CALLS AND HAVING MAJOR ISSUES WITH THIS ISSUE. THEY WILL DO…”NHTSA complaint 10638716 — filed 09/24/2014
“MY REAR WINDOW HAS STARTED TO SEPARATE FROM THE CONVERTIBLE TOP MY CAR WAS PARKED AND HAS NOT BEEN DRIVEN SUDDENLY I LOOKED AT MY…”NHTSA complaint 10546526 — filed 10/02/2013
“CAME OUT OF A STORE TO FIND THE REAR WINDOW OF MY WIFE'S 2005 CROSSFIRE CONVERTIBLE HAD BECOME UNGLUED ALONG BOTH SIDES, THE BOTTOM &…”NHTSA complaint 10536782 — filed 08/22/2013

Excerpts are shortened and scrubbed of personal details; they are individual, unverified reports.

Does the 2005 Chrysler Crossfire have visibility/wiper problems?

Visibility/wiper is the #3 most-reported problem area on the 2005 Chrysler Crossfire: 28 of 189 complaints on file (14.8%). Complaints are unverified owner reports, not confirmed defects.

How many complaints does the 2005 Chrysler Crossfire have in total?

189 complaints were on file with NHTSA as of 07/12/2026. Across all categories, 1 involved a crash, 0 involved a fire, 3 reported injuries, and none reported deaths.
